Love of the Poet

When any flowers fade away And dust will cover mirrors strongly When you reflect you’ll have to stay As water’s image that is lonely. When you will tire of looking, pal, And stare in floor among sad faces Love will appear to write your tale To capture you and all your places. It must be makes you play with words You will be laughing you’ll be crying You will be brave despising gods You’re spreading wings, you will be flying. You’ll fly with love in Neverland Do not look back it is forbidden And lines of verse will never end The pen is working – poem’s written. When poet will wake up in heart You have no sleep the dreams are fading White wings accept again their part Love came to you. You need no landing. You’ll fall asleep before the dawn There is one thing – you will be thinking That you are drunk with love, it won, You are the poet, love is winking.
